Kernel Fehler verursacht Absturz auf Cubox-i

Welches Modul/Treiber für welche Hardware, Kernel compilieren...
Antworten
spacken
Beiträge: 29
Registriert: 07.08.2009 11:11:17

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von spacken » 12.06.2014 10:20:30

Ich betreibe jetzt seit einer Weile eine Cubox-i u.a. als Seafile-server. Allerdings stürzt der Server immer mal wieder ab und ich weiß nicht genau, woran das liegt. Als ClamAV im Hintergrund lief und sich ab und zu aktualisiert hat trat das Problem fast jeden zweiten Tag auf.

Heute wollte ich den Seafile-server aktualisieren und bekam folgende Meldungen über SSH bis er dann wieder nicht mehr zu erreichen war:

Code: Alles auswählen

In »»seafile-server_3.0.4_pi.tar.gz«« speichern.

 6% [===>                                                              ] 1.222.835    329K/s  ETA 51s     
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Internal error: Oops: 5 [#1] PREEMPT SMP

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Process log (pid: 25814, stack limit = 0xe4af22f0)

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Stack: (0xe4af3f18 to 0xe4af4000)

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3f00:                                                       00000000 cc0a3330

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3f20: cc072eb0 8010e53c ffffffa3 e43a8500 cc0a3330 cc072eb0 00000000 8010f830

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3f40: ffffffa3 e43a8500 cc072eb0 cc0a3330 00000000 800fe2bc 00000020 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3f60: e43a8500 e42d07e0 00000000 e43a8500 80044044 e4af2000 00000000 800fad2c

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3f80: 0000001b e42d07e0 e42d0820 800fade8 2abb544c 00000000 2abb5448 2abb5b30

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3fa0: 00000006 80043ec0 00000000 2abb5448 0000001b 00000001 0000001b 2abb544c

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3fc0: 00000000 2abb5448 2abb5b30 00000006 2abb432c 00000000 2ab18e9c 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:3fe0: 2abb5b30 7ea20bf0 2ab8cfaf 2ac6459c 60000010 0000001b 00000000 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Code: e1a00234 e0830200 e8bd0010 e12fff1e (e5903008) 

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Internal error: Oops: 17 [#2] PREEMPT SMP

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Process ssl-params (pid: 25817, stack limit = 0xe41b42f0)

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Stack: (0xe41b5ea8 to 0xe41b6000)

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5ea0:                   00000000 cc0302a8 cc072758 8010e53c 00000000 e9fc36e0

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5ec0: cc0302a8 cc072758 00000000 8010f830 00000003 e4b98780 cc072758 cc0302a8

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5ee0: 00000000 800fe2bc 00000020 00000000 e4b98780 e42d0c40 00000000 e42d0c40

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5f00: 0000000c e41b4000 00000000 800fad2c 00000000 000000ff e42d0c48 8007ca64

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5f20: 00000000 e4adb480 00000000 e484d6c0 e4097100 00000089 0000004b 8007d0a4

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5f40: ffffffa3 e43a8640 e41b4000 00000001 00000000 800fe2bc 00000020 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5f60: e43a8640 e4097100 00000000 e41b4000 000000f8 80044044 e41b4000 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5f80: 00000000 8007d494 00000000 0006efae 2ae79774 2ae79774 000000f8 8007d518

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5fa0: 00000000 80043ec0 0006efae 2ae79774 00000000 0006ef9a 2ab474c0 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5fc0: 0006efae 2ae79774 2ae79774 000000f8 538e1749 00000000 2ab7cee0 00000000

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:5fe0: 000000f8 7ee58ad4 2ae0c0f3 2adb0f96 60000030 00000000 79ffc811 79ffcc11

Message from syslogd@localhost at Jun 12 09:57:07 ...
 kernel:Code: e1a00234 e0830200 e8bd0010 e12fff1e (e5903008) 
 8% [====>                                                             ] 1.555.835    327K/s  ETA 54s     
Es kommt Kernel "3.0.35" zum Einsatz, der speziell für die Cubox-i gepatched wurde. Ansonsten läuft wheezy. Liegt hier vielleicht schon das Problem? Was passiert hier eigentlich? Was sind die Ursachen? Das ganze ist halt sehr unpraktisch, weil ich den Server aus der ferne nicht mal eben schnell neustarten kann...

Benutzeravatar
habakug
Moderator
Beiträge: 4314
Registriert: 23.10.2004 13:08:41
Lizenz eigener Beiträge: MIT Lizenz

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von habakug » 12.06.2014 11:09:03

Hallo!

Wo hast du den Kernel denn her? Aus dem Solid-Run-Image? Der Rechner/Download scheint ja weiter zu laufen. Du könntest mal die exakten Meldungen aus syslog nachreichen, was er so auf die Konsole spuckt ist nicht nur hilfreich.
Du könntest dir auf deinem Debian auch einen Kernel selbst bauen [2]. Es hat auch Probleme mit gcc gegeben [1], daher meine Frage nach der Herkunft des Kernels.

Gruss, habakug

[1] https://gcc.gnu.org/bugzilla/show_bug.cgi?id=58854
[2] http://releases.linaro.org/14.06/compon ... ils-linaro
( # = root | $ = user | !! = mod ) (Vor der PN) (Debianforum-Wiki) (NoPaste)

spacken
Beiträge: 29
Registriert: 07.08.2009 11:11:17

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von spacken » 12.06.2014 12:12:43

Der Kernel ist der aus dem Solidrun Jessie Image vom Januar. Hab den rest dann nur mit einer Wheezy armhf installation ersetzt.
Der Download läuft nicht weiter. Die gepostete Ausgabe ist das letzte, was über SSH gesendet wurde.
Sobald der Server wieder läuft(bin gerade nicht zu Hause), versuche ich die Syslogs nachzureichen.
Kernel selber bauen hat beim letzten mal nicht funktioniert. Er wollte das dann immer nicht booten, deswegen würde ich lieber eine einfachere Methode probieren. Ich brauche auch keine Video Ausgabe, allerdings wollte ich noch MPD betreiben aber derzeit wird die Soundkarte nicht unterstützt...

Vielen Dank schonmal!

spacken
Beiträge: 29
Registriert: 07.08.2009 11:11:17

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von spacken » 13.06.2014 20:36:17

Hi!
Server läuft wieder, deshalb lege ich jetzt mal dies syslogs nach:

Code: Alles auswählen

Jun 11 23:00:20 localhost postfix/pickup[22763]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 00:40:23 localhost postfix/pickup[22800]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 02:20:26 localhost postfix/pickup[22834]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 04:00:32 localhost postfix/pickup[22866]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 05:40:37 localhost postfix/pickup[22901]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 07:20:42 localhost postfix/pickup[22939]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 09:00:47 localhost postfix/pickup[22968]: warning: inet_protocols: disabling IPv6 name/address support: Address family not supported by protocol
Jun 12 09:55:36 localhost dovecot: master: Dovecot v2.1.7 starting up (core dumps disabled)
Jun 12 09:55:36 localhost dovecot: ssl-params: Generating SSL parameters
Jun 12 09:55:37 localhost dovecot: master: Warning: Killed with signal 15 (by pid=23202 uid=0 code=kill)
Jun 12 09:56:19 localhost dovecot: master: Dovecot v2.1.7 starting up (core dumps disabled)
Jun 12 09:56:21 localhost dovecot: master: Warning: Killed with signal 15 (by pid=25929 uid=0 code=kill)
Jun 12 09:56:21 localhost dovecot: master: Dovecot v2.1.7 starting up (core dumps disabled)
Jun 12 21:50:02 localhost kernel: imklog 5.8.11, log source = /proc/kmsg started.
Das ist jetzt aus der "/var/log/syslog.1". Sagt aber nicht wirklich was aus oder?

Benutzeravatar
habakug
Moderator
Beiträge: 4314
Registriert: 23.10.2004 13:08:41
Lizenz eigener Beiträge: MIT Lizenz

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von habakug » 14.06.2014 09:08:11

Hallo!

Ich habe zufällig auch einen imx6q von SolidRun. Das ist ein nettes Maschinchen. Ich habe mir u.a. einen Kernel 3.10.30 aus dem linaro-Tree gebaut (und einige Patches eingepflegt). Dieser Kernel hat funktionierendes WLAN und Sound. Außerdem läuft die Grafik (X), lediglich die Beschleunigung möchte nicht (hier gibt es z.Zt. sowieso nur geschlossene Firmware-Blobs). Ich habe ein Kabel für eine 2.5" Festplatte (eSata und USB), die Unterstützung für eSata ist aber leider erst im Kernel 3.15. Mit 3.15 habe ich leider z.Zt. kein WLAN (und haufenweise andere Probleme). Ich könnte dir bei Interesse einen Dropbox-Link schicken, damit du dir den Kernel 3.10 und die Module herunterladen kannst.

Code: Alles auswählen

$ aplay -l
**** List of PLAYBACK Hardware Devices ****
card 0: imxspdif [imx-spdif], device 0: S/PDIF PCM Playback dit-hifi-0 []
  Subdevices: 1/1
  Subdevice #0: subdevice #0
card 1: imxhdmisoc [imx-hdmi-soc], device 0: i.MX HDMI Audio Tx hdmi-hifi-0 []
  Subdevices: 1/1
  Subdevice #0: subdevice #0
# iw dev wlan0 info
Interface wlan0
	ifindex 7
	wdev 0x1
	addr b8:5a:f7:01:b5:5c
	type managed
	wiphy 0
Übrigens sieht es so aus, als würden mit dem kommenden Kernel 3.16 einige Probleme behoben werden.

Gruss, habakug
( # = root | $ = user | !! = mod ) (Vor der PN) (Debianforum-Wiki) (NoPaste)

spacken
Beiträge: 29
Registriert: 07.08.2009 11:11:17

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von spacken » 14.06.2014 10:42:48

Danke!

Also ich hab eine Cubox-i2Ultra mit dem i.MX6 Dual Prozessor. Würde der Kernel damit auch funktionieren? Sind ja eigentlich nur 2 Kerne weniger.
Ansonsten würdest du mir damit natürlich sehr weiter helfen. Ich hoffe der ist dann stabiler. Allerdings kann ich das ganze nicht vor nächstem Wochenende ausprobieren, weil ich vorher nicht wieder zu Hause bin. Aber wenn du mir einen Dropbox Link per PN schicken könntest wär das super.
Mit dem Sound muss ich dann nochmal probieren. Hab nämlich gerade gemerkt, dass ALSA gar nicht installiert war. Vielleicht lag es daran. Allerdings wollte ich den Sound unverändert per spdif oder Hdmi Schnittstelle rausschicken. Dazu brauch ich doch eigentlich keinen Mixer oder?
Kann ich aber alles auch erst nächstes Wochenende ausprobieren.

Code: Alles auswählen

aplay -L                                                                                                                                                                                                
null                                                                                                                                                                                                                             
    Discard all samples (playback) or generate zero samples (capture)                                                                                                                                                            
default:CARD=imxspdif                                                                                                                                                                                                            
    imx-spdif,                                                                                                                                                                                                                   
    Default Audio Device                                                                                                                                                                                                         
sysdefault:CARD=imxspdif                                                                                                                                                                                                         
    imx-spdif,                                                                                                                                                                                                                   
    Default Audio Device
default:CARD=imxhdmisoc
    imx-hdmi-soc, 
    Default Audio Device
sysdefault:CARD=imxhdmisoc
    imx-hdmi-soc, 
    Default Audio Device

Colttt
Beiträge: 3012
Registriert: 16.10.2008 23:25:34
Wohnort: Brandenburg
Kontaktdaten:

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von Colttt » 14.06.2014 12:05:41

Ist etwas OT aber kann das teil auch ruckelfrei 1080p abspielen? Wie siehts mit WLAN aus?

Ich suche nämlich ein minipc der das kann.. Viele androidsticks/boxen scheitern nämlich genau daran und sind teilweise relativ teuer..
Debian-Nutzer :D

ZABBIX Certified Specialist

spacken
Beiträge: 29
Registriert: 07.08.2009 11:11:17

Re: Kernel Fehler verursacht Absturz auf Cubox-i

Beitrag von spacken » 14.06.2014 12:56:08

Also die Cubox-i ist ziemlich vielseitig. Und für den Preis ist es ziemlich gut ausgestattet [1]. Der Linux Hardwaresupport wird immer besser. Es gibt aber nicht so viel doku wie z.B beim Raspberry Pi. Es gibt ein Android 4.3 Image, was ziemlich einfach zu installieren ist [2]. Sollte dann auch 1080p können.

[1] http://youtu.be/y4OpjoJiAGE?t=32m4s
[2] http://imx.solid-run.com/wiki/index.php?title=Android

Antworten